Polisario Front Threatens Military Action Against Morocco Over Guerguerat Zone
The "Sahrawi Popular Liberation Army" (APLS) plans to go to war against Morocco after the Royal Armed Forces (FAR) deployed a security cordon in the Guerguerat buffer zone on Friday to secure the flow of goods and people. A military operation that routed the Polisario militiamen.
"There is no more room for speeches, the homeland or death as a martyr to complete sovereignty," a APLS officer says in a video broadcast by several media outlets, including the Russian channel RT. This officer addressed operational units. For him, the moment of truth has arrived. The "Sahrawi" army "is ready to (execute) any decision taken by the Polisario Front and its leadership," he said, adding that the special unit is ready for combat and is on post.
On Saturday, the "Sahrawi" army issued a statement to announce the continuation of its intensive attacks on Moroccan military bases. "The units of the APLS continue their attacks on the different positions of the enemy located in the different regions of the Western Sahara, causing human and material losses to the forces of the Moroccan occupation and a state of confusion as to its military plans."
